Hamilton
Celebrate the return of the Hamilton Broadway show to Chicago this fall! This epic saga follows the rise of Founding Father Alexander Hamilton as he fights for honor, love, and a legacy that would shape the course of a nation.
Based on Ron Chernow’s acclaimed biography and set to a score that blends hip-hop, jazz, R&B, and Broadway, Hamilton is a revolutionary show that has had a profound impact on culture, politics, and education.
Hamilton features book, music, lyrics by Lin-Manuel Miranda, direction by Thomas Kail, choreography by Andy Blankenbuehler, and musical supervision and orchestrations by Alex Lacamoire. In addition to its 11 Tony® Awards, it has won Grammy®, Olivier Awards, and the Pulitzer Prize for Drama.

The Lehman Trilogy
The Lehman Trilogy, the winner of the 2022 Tony Award for Best Play, weaves together nearly two centuries of family history in an epic theatrical event charting the humble beginnings, outrageous successes, and devastating failure of the financial institution that would ultimately bring the global economy to its knees.
Told in three parts over one evening, The Lehman Trilogy is the story of Western capitalism through the lens of a single immigrant family. One of the most impactful Broadway shows in Chicago, the story starts off with a young Jewish man from Bavaria standing on a New York dockside, dreaming of a new life in the new world. His two brothers soon join him, and an American epic begins.
Sixty-three years later, the prominent firm they established—Lehman Brothers—came crumbling down, triggering the largest financial crisis in history.

The Wiz
Watch out because the beloved Tony Award®-winning Musical is coming back to Chicago! This is the first Broadway-bound tour in 40 years where The Wiz is returning to all stages across America, so you better grab a ticket!
The Wiz features a book by William F. Brown and a Tony Award-winning score by Charlie Smalls (and others), director Schele Williams (The Notebook, revival of Disney’s Aida), award-winning choreographer JaQuel Knight (Beyoncé’s “Single Ladies,” Black is King),
From its iconic score packed with soul, gospel, and rock to its stirring tale of Dorothy’s journey to find her place in a contemporary world, this groundbreaking twist on The Wizard of Oz changed the face of Broadway.
